Wheatgrass Juice is a Great Spring Tonic

 

Back in the good old days, which means from when I was a kid to when my grandparents were kids, everyone had to take a mix called Spring Tonic at this time of the year. When the days started to lengthen and nature started to sprout new growth, my mother would bring out the tablespoon and the bottle and wed all groan and complain. After the tablespoon of vile-tasting stuff was down wed get a candy to cover the taste but it sure took a while. This went on for a week or until the bottle was empty.

The reasoning behind the tonic was that our blood was sluggish from the long winter and the tonic would clean out our blood and make the sap rise as if we were young trees. The ingredients could be found out in the woods and the meadows before it was distilled into the bottled elixir that my family bought. You could go out and collect dandelion greens, violet leaves, sorrel, chickweed, nettles; pretty much anything that was new and green and bitter and tasted bad. There was definately a widely held opinion that medicine had to taste bad to be any good for you.

The herbal mixtures were all rich in enzymes, minerals, trace elements, and protein components, plus they all had chlorophyll from the green plants. In places that had gone the whole winter on stored root vegetables, people didnt even have to be persuaded to take the tonic. They would head out to the woods as soon as the snow cleared.
